**CI note — Pickwise optimizer pipeline**

If the optimizer's integration stage fails on the Harrowfield runners with a timeout, it's usually the synthetic warehouse fixture taking too long to seed. Re-run once before escalating; flaky seeds account for most failures. Persistent failures mean the bin-layout schema changed without updating the fixture generator. Check the last green run and diff the schema. The failing job prints its trace token at the end of the log, shown here.

build token for fajof-yahof: htk4_869f

## Authentication

The Monthsplitter service partitions the ledger tables by calendar month and requires an API key for every call to the internal partition-control endpoint. Keys are scoped to partition management only; they cannot read row data. Rotation happens quarterly, and all requests are logged with the key fingerprint for audit. For this deployment, the reviewer-accessible staging key is included immediately below this section.

app token of tafof-kagug = vxb7-rjfGwYC

**Ticket: Intermittent DNS failures hitting quartzfeed-api**

Hey on-call — we're seeing flaky resolution for the internal quartzfeed-api hostname, maybe 1 in 40 lookups times out and the retry path isn't catching it. Started after the Wrenlake cluster resolver upgrade, so that's suspect number one. Pods in the batch tier are hit hardest. Restarting the node-local cache helps for ~20 minutes, then it's back. Repro trace is attached below for reference.

pipeline stamp: htk4_ae36